  • "Shawn Collins, 3M Application Engineer, walks through the process for performing a two-sided plastic repair on a damaged bumper. Whether you’re looking at cracks, tears, or punctures, this process can help you get the repair done.
    Important notes (00:25)
    Wear proper PPE: safety glasses, protective gloves, respirator and whatever else you need for the job. This video is intended for a professional setting such as a body shop or paint shop. Make sure to check OEM recommendations to confirm you’re using the correct adhesive for the job.

      Possibly, however consider possibly having to blend into adjacent panels on some colors if replacing. If the damage is in the center of the cover, you can save the OEM color on the ends and not have to blend into adjacent panels. Nothing worse than seeing a car on the street where the bumper cover and the quarter panel don’t match perfectly. Not to mention, most aftermarket covers don’t fit well and the gaps may look poor. Also the materials aren’t expensive if you can repair 4-6 bumpers with one cartridge of adhesive. If you’re buying the materials to repair one bumper, then it may not make sense. All situations are different.
